Job Description
Built on meritocracy, our unique company culture rewards self-starters and those who are committed to doing what is best for our customers.
As the local leader of the Regional Internal Operations Audit Associates and Auditors, the Insurance Operations Audit Manager is actively engaged with all aspects of the audit team, performing all team responsibilities, and monitoring the progress toward departmental goals. The Audit Manager supports the Regional Director and is responsible for tracking and managing expenses, monitoring team performance, and improving the efficiency and effectiveness of the local team and other tasks as needed by the Regional Director.
Essential Duties and Functions:
  • Conduct Orientations for new Profit Centers, as needed.
  • Participate in company meetings, as necessary.
  • Frequently communicates with teammates and engaged parties regarding project status and timeliness to manage expectations and ensure deadlines are met.
  • Assist Regional Director by leading and / or completing audits as needed and monitoring audits to ensure timely and successful completion.
  • Provides significant input on the regional audit schedule and identifies the teammates responsible for the audits.
  • Conducts performance reviews for all regional insurance operations auditors and associates.
  • Perform Due Diligence for potential acquisitions, if needed.
  • With the approval of the Regional Directors, develops and distributes processes / workflow manuals as needed.
  • Develop and / or enhance technical insurance knowledge. Pursuit of insurance related designations in conjunction with the Regional Director.
  • Review teammate PTO/DTO and expenses. Monitor team travel plans with an eye on expenses.
  • Participates in sourcing, interviewing, and recruiting candidates for the region.
  • Develop and maintain relationships with the internal operations audit divisions (IO, FO, TR, IT).
  • Manages the day-to-day activities and projects of the Regional Insurance Operations Auditors and Associates with a focus on ensuring 100% utilization of available resources on either audits or other special projects.
  • Evaluate viability of retesting the Profit Center’s action plans. Concerns should be discussed with Profit Center and / or Regional Director.
  • Track progress of regional team in completing all audit activities, including the timely & successful distribution of all Insurance Operations reports. Provide assistance or elevate concerns as needed to ensure timely outcomes.
  • Oversees onboarding of new hires within the region.
  • Perform other specific duties and projects as assigned by the Regional Director.
  • Organizes, tracks, and reports any and/all special projects to the Regional Director.
  • Review and approve timecards of the associate level teammates.
